Nausea and vomiting of pregnancy is a common condition that settles by 20 weeks in 9 out of 10 pregnant women. Nausea and vomiting during pregnancy are an unfortunate reality for many. Morning sickness is the unpleasant symptom you experience in the first trimester, where you are constantly running to the bathroom to vomit, or just feeling nauseous. Understanding the causes — from morning sickness. Management of patients with nausea and vomiting of pregnancy (nvp) depends upon symptom severity, the impact of symptoms on. It usually starts within four weeks of the last menstrual period and peaks at nine weeks' gestation. Hyperemesis gravidarum usually occurs during the first trimester of your pregnancy (beginning around six weeks of pregnancy).
